POSITION SUMMARY/OBJECTIVE: The Director of Facilities and Construction oversees all aspects of facilities management, construction, and maintenance for a fast casual restaurant chain. This role ensures that new locations are built to company standards, existing facilities are well-maintained, and operational needs are met efficiently and cost-effectively.

WORK ENVIRONMENT:
The Director of Construction & Facilities works in an office and in the field. The Director uses a computer, telephone and other office equipment as needed to perform duties. Job sites can be noisy and dangerous which will require the Director wear appropriate PPP.
When visiting Restaurants, the employee will be exposed to distracting noises and sound levels from cooktops, hot temperatures from fryers and grills, sharp utensils and equipment, wet flooring, and cold temperatures when dealing with walk in coolers/freezer. Restaurant kitchens are often small spaces, they may work near others, while maintaining social distancing.
PHYSICAL DEMANDS:
The employee is regularly required to sit, talk, or hear. The employee will frequently be required to use repetitive hand motion, handle, or feel, and to stand, walk, reach, bend or lift up to 40 pounds.
When visiting Restaurants, the Director could be required to stand/sit/walk for long periods of time, along with frequent bending, kneeling, lifting, balancing, pulling, pushing, crouching, stooping, reaching, crawling, twisting, eye hand and foot coordination, neck flexion, and neck twisting.
